What is Python?

  • Python is a high level, interpreted, interactive and object-oriented scripting language
  • The language has been designed to be readable and uses English keywords frequently
    • Other programming languages rely upon the usage of punctuation

Interpreted, Interactive and Object-Oriented?

  • Interpreted means that the language is processed at runtime by the interpreter and therefore you are not required to compile the program before execution
  • Interactive means that you can interact with the Python interpreter directly in order to write your programs
  • Object-Oriented means that Python supports the object-oriented style of programming; whereby the code is encapsulated within objects

History of Python

  • Python was first developed by Guido van Rossum in the late 1980’s and early 1990’s
  • The language is derived from other languages such as: C++, Unix shell etc.

Features of Python

  • The language is easy to learn
  • There is a broad standard library
  • Students can interact with the language
  • The language is portable and extendable
  • Supports databases and graphical user interfaces

Advantages of Python

  • Python can be used for a wide variety of tasks, such as:
    • Web Development
    • Embedded Applications
    • Gaming
    • Data Processing and Visualisation
  • A large collection of libraries and resources
  • Improves a developers productivity
  • Support for machine learning and artificial intelligence

macOS and Linux

  • Typing python3 into the terminal window will call the Python interpreter

Windows

  • Typing py or python3 into the command-line or PowerShell will call the Python interpreter
    • only a single command will work
    • depends upon how you installed Python on your machine

Python IDLE

  • The integrated development and learning environment for Python
  • Available on macOS, Linux and Windows and installed alongside the Python interpreter
  • A multi-window text editor which has colour-coded input, output and error messages
  • Provides features to debug your code with persistent breakpoints, stepping and the ability to view global and local namespaces
